Brownstones that take a breath again

Manhattan's brownstones age with dignity until overlook, moisture, or negative restorations catch up. A great Brownstone improvement architect Manhattan recognizes structure makeup. Joists could be sistered, however you need to check out why they sagged. That garden-level dampness might be a flat walkway pitch, an absent leader, or a long-ago oil storage tank removal. The company has peeled back more than a couple of floorings to find enthusiastic 1980s intermediaries that require steel, old timber with powder post beetle trails, or masonry that wants lime mortar, not Rose city cement.

In one West 80s townhouse, an earlier engineer had actually carved a double-height gallery into the rear bay, which looked significant however created severe temperature swings and unusual audio bounce. Baobab rebuilt a stepped mezzanine that brought back room-to-room intimacy while keeping a thoughtful vertical connection. They embeded a hidden textile acoustical layer and a discreet ducted system, so the new area checks out calm rather than spacious. The family quits there each morning. That is the mark of spaces that draw individuals in.

On an additional job in Harlem, a garden service had a ceiling hardly removing seven feet. Decreasing the slab would have set off a tangle of waterproofing and supports. Rather, the group pressed daytime from over with an enlarged stairway opening, glass risers, and a skylight sized just timid of what Landmarks would allow. They reclaimed the sensation of height without digging a toe right into the aquifer. Kitchens, bathrooms, and the truthful hustle of daily life

Architectural design services for residential homes New York City commonly fixate bathroom and kitchens for good reason. These are the rooms with plumbing, airing vent, and ceramic tile patterns that will evaluate your persistence. Baobab develops kitchens that gain their maintain. Counter runs quit at reasonable factors. Job lighting is layered, not scattered. They establish clear touch zones so two individuals can prepare without crash. Products obtain specified with a practical upkeep plan. If a customer desires soapstone but runs a high-heat wok most nights, the firm will certainly talk through the patina and propose a heat-tolerant insert, rather than marketing a fantasy.

Bathrooms are where waterproofing either works or it does not. A typical detail package might include pre-slope representations, curb transitions, and exact positioning of shower particular niches to strike tile component joints. These are not glamorous decisions, yet they are the kind that make a job really feel tranquil 5 years later. The firm tracks which cement and sealers do with time in New york city water conditions. Sustainability in a city that punishes waste

New York is dense enough that power use folds up right into next-door neighbor comfort and code restrictions. The company favors passive methods first. Alignment and home window choice to regulate warm gain, continual insulation to kill thermal bridges, and air securing that strikes numbers a blower door can verify. Where mechanical systems matter, they steer customers towards heatpump sized by tons computation, not wishful thinking. They are comfortable with ERVs in limited envelopes and have actually incorporated radiant floorings where it makes sense as opposed to as a reflex. In townhouses with tall stacks, they tame pile result with compartmentalization and careful vestibule design.

Materials come under scrutiny also. The workplace maintains a running log of vendors with reliable EPDs and avoids greenwashing. They do not oversell net-zero desires to households that travel for work and host a dozen people every weekend break. However they will certainly reveal you how to cost out induction with correct electrical preparation, how to keep a gas line for a back-up grill if you must, and just how to future-proof a panel for an EV charger in a garage you show to 3 other owners. A couple of functional takeaways if you are intending a project

    Decide rapidly whether you are prioritizing routine, budget, or scope, then stay with that pecking order. You can strike two strongly, the third will flex. Ask your architect to show one or two constructed examples of an information you respect many. Images and a telephone call with a past client are worth a dozen renderings. Confirm building and co-op rules before design obtains too much. Venting, acoustic underlay, and wet-over-dry restrictions can reshape a plan. Order long-lead items early, particularly home windows and plumbing fixtures. The calendar is as actual a constraint as the lot line. Hold a surface example in your hand and pour water, oil, or coffee on it if that will be its fate. Upkeep is not theoretical.
